稀土元素硼化物的研究进展 被引量:12

Research Development of Rare Earth Boride

摘要 稀土元素硼化物具有特有的机械、热和电等优良特性,特别是功函数小、硬度大、熔点高、导电率高、杨氏模量高、热稳定性好、化学稳定性高等特点。能满足场发射性能要求的较低的开启电场和阂值电场,较大的场发射增强因子和稳定的发射电流等优良特性。该材料广泛用于工业及国防工业的各个领域。从稀土元素硼化物的概念出发,介绍了稀土元素硼化物的特性、应用和国内外的研究进展,简述了二元、三元稀土元素硼化物主要产品及其合成方法,对我国稀土元素硼化物今后的研究方向和重点内容提出了建议。 Rare earth borides have good mechanical, thermal and electrical properties, especially have small work func- tion, high hardness,high melting point,high conductivity,high Yang's modulus, good thermal stability and good chemical sta- bility. They can meet the requirements of lower turn - on voltage, lower threshold field, high field enhancement factor and sta- ble emission current for field emission. The materials are widely used in civil and military fields. Characteristics, applications and research development of rare earth borides were introduced in this paper. Main products and synthetic methods of rare earth boride were summarized. Research direction and focus of China' s rare earth boride were discussed.
